Morphological Analysis kai {καὶ | kaí}: and (coordinating conjunction) • ērchonto {ἤρχοντο | ḗr-khon-to}: they were coming (verb • imperfect middle or passive indicative third person plural) • pros {πρὸς | prós}: to • toward (preposition with accusative) • auton {αὐτόν | au-tón}: him (personal pronoun • accusative masculine singular) • kai {καὶ | kaí}: and (coordinating conjunction) • elegon {ἔλεγον | é-le-gon}: they were saying (verb • imperfect active indicative third person plural) • khaire {Χαῖρε | khaî-re}: hail • rejoice (verb • present active imperative second person singular) • ho {ὁ | ho}: the (definite article • nominative masculine singular) • basileus {βασιλεὺς | ba-si-leús}: king (noun • nominative masculine singular) • tōn {τῶν | tôn}: of the (definite article • genitive masculine plural) • Ioudaiōn {Ἰουδαίων | I-ou-daí-ōn}: Jews (noun • genitive masculine plural) • kai {καὶ | kaí}: and (coordinating conjunction) • edidosan {ἐδίδοσαν | e-dí-do-san}: they were giving (verb • imperfect active indicative third person plural) • autō {αὐτῷ | au-tôi}: to him (personal pronoun • dative masculine singular) • rhapsimata {ῥαπίσματα | rhap-ís-ma-ta}: blows • slaps (noun • accusative neuter plural) |
